How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Holland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Holland Park Studio Apartments | $1,056 | $775 | $1,392 |
Holland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,354 | $849 | $2,100 |
Holland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,752 | $1,025 | $2,651 |
Holland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,074 | $1,650 | $2,952 |

Getting Around the Holland Park Neighborhood in Colorado Springs, CO
Walk Score®
47 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
54 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
30 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
